PKG Group of Institutions Fee, Structure
There are various courses offered by PKG Group of Institutions in the admission session 2025. Candidates seeking admissions can choose from a variety of courses from fields of Business and Management Studies and Engineering, etc. The course fee varies with different PKG Group of Institutions courses and course levels. Candidates who qualify through the PKG Group of Institutions admission process can pay the fee of the opted course. The tuition fee ranges between INR 1,96,500 - 2,08,000 for PKG Group of Institutions. Below is PKG Group of Institutions fee for all courses:

| Courses | Eligibility |
|---|---|
| B.E. / B.Tech | Candidate should have passed in Physics and Mathematics as compulsory subjects along with one of the following subjects Chemistry/ Bio-Technology/ Biology/ Technical Vocational subject taken together with above mentioned percentage for General category and 40% in case of reserved category in 10+2 from a recognized Board/University. Candidate who have passed Diploma (in Engineering and Technology) with at least 45% marks in case of General category and 40% in case of reserved category are also eligible to apply. Candidate who has passed Physics, chemistry and Mathematics in his/ her Diploma Course, then his/ her Diploma is equivalent to 10+2(Non-Medical). |
| BBA | Candidate must have passed Class XII in any discipline from a recognized board |
| After 10th Diploma | Candidate must have passed class 10th or equivalent SSC Examination. Candidate must have secure at least 35% marks (33% in case of candidates belonging to Scheduled Castes and Scheduled Tribes category or Kashmiri Migrants Category) at the qualifying examination. Candidate must have passed in Mathematics and Science subjects in his / her qualifying examination |
| M.E./M.Tech | Candidate must have passed B.Tech. / B.E / B.sc in the respective field of study from a recognized university and AICTE approved institution |
| MBA/PGDM | Bachelor's Degree of 3 years duration in any discipline from a recognized university with not less than above mentioned marks in aggregate (47.5% marks in aggregate, in case of SC/ST candidates) |
| B.Ed | Candidates must have obtained minimum of 50% marks (45% marks for SC/ST candidates of Haryana State only) either in the Bachelor Degree and /or in the Master's Degree or any other Qualification recognized as equivalent in order to take admission to the programme. In case an applicant has done the Master Degree also after graduation Degree, the higher percentage of marks scored in either of the two will be taken into consideration while making the merit. Candidates with compartment will not be allowed for admission in B.Ed. (Regular Course) under any circumstances. One year PG Diploma in any stream will not be considered equal to Master's degree. The requirement of 50% marks shall not apply to persons appointed as teachers prior to the commencement of the National Council for Teacher Education. |
| UG Diploma | Candidate must have completed 10+2 from any recognised Board/Council. |
